using Ardalis.GuardClauses;
using Microsoft.AspNetCore.Mvc;
using Microsoft.AspNetCore.Mvc.RazorPages;
using Microsoft.eShopWeb.ApplicationCore.Entities;
using Microsoft.eShopWeb.ApplicationCore.Interfaces;
using Microsoft.eShopWeb.Web.Interfaces;
using Microsoft.eShopWeb.Web.ViewModels;
namespace Microsoft.eShopWeb.Web.Pages.Basket;
public class IndexModel : PageModel
{
private readonly IBasketService _basketService;
private readonly IBasketViewModelService _basketViewModelService;
private readonly IRepository<CatalogItem> _itemRepository;
public IndexModel(IBasketService basketService,
IBasketViewModelService basketViewModelService,
IRepository<CatalogItem> itemRepository)
{
_basketService = basketService;
_basketViewModelService = basketViewModelService;
_itemRepository = itemRepository;
}
public BasketViewModel BasketModel { get; set; } = new BasketViewModel();
public async Task OnGet()
{
BasketModel = await _basketViewModelService.GetOrCreateBasketForUser(GetOrSetBasketCookieAndUserName());
}
public async Task<IActionResult> OnPost(CatalogItemViewModel productDetails)
{
if (productDetails?.Id == null)
{
return RedirectToPage("/Index");
}
var item = await _itemRepository.GetByIdAsync(productDetails.Id);
if (item == null)
{
return RedirectToPage("/Index");
}
var username = GetOrSetBasketCookieAndUserName();
var basket = await _basketService.AddItemToBasket(username,
productDetails.Id, item.Price);
BasketModel = await _basketViewModelService.Map(basket);
return RedirectToPage();
}
public async Task OnPostUpdate(IEnumerable<BasketItemViewModel> items)
{
if (!ModelState.IsValid)
{
return;
}
var basketView = await _basketViewModelService.GetOrCreateBasketForUser(GetOrSetBasketCookieAndUserName());
var updateModel = items.ToDictionary(b => b.Id.ToString(), b => b.Quantity);
var basket = await _basketService.SetQuantities(basketView.Id, updateModel);
BasketModel = await _basketViewModelService.Map(basket);
}
private string GetOrSetBasketCookieAndUserName()
{
Guard.Against.Null(Request.HttpContext.User.Identity, nameof(Request.HttpContext.User.Identity));
string? userName = null;
if (Request.HttpContext.User.Identity.IsAuthenticated)
{
Guard.Against.Null(Request.HttpContext.User.Identity.Name, nameof(Request.HttpContext.User.Identity.Name));
return Request.HttpContext.User.Identity.Name!;
}
if (Request.Cookies.ContainsKey(Constants.BASKET_COOKIENAME))
{
userName = Request.Cookies[Constants.BASKET_COOKIENAME];
if (!Request.HttpContext.User.Identity.IsAuthenticated)
{
if (!Guid.TryParse(userName, out var _))
{
userName = null;
}
}
}
if (userName != null) return userName;
userName = Guid.NewGuid().ToString();
var cookieOptions = new CookieOptions { IsEssential = true };
cookieOptions.Expires = DateTime.Today.AddYears(10);
Response.Cookies.Append(Constants.BASKET_COOKIENAME, userName, cookieOptions);
return userName;
}
}
